Srinagar Airport adds spa, newly renovated restaurant for passengers
Srinagar: Waiting for flights is now an enjoyable experience. Passengers can now sip their favorite Tea/Coffee, accomplished shopping etc and would soon be able to visit a spa or relax at waiting lounge that have come up at the renovated and extended security hold area at first floor of Srinagar airport.
Shri Sharad Kumar, Airport Director told that over the years, Srinagar airport has undergone significant transformation, suffice it to recall what this airport was last year, renovation of 10 no toilet blocks, replacement of granite flooring in terminal building and veranda, new canopy at arrival exit, extension of check-in hall with seven extra counters, installation of common users self service(CUSS) counter, replacement of four X-bis machines, canopy at baggage make-up area and ticketing counters , award of two aerobridges, provision of 450 new passengers trolleys, art gallery in SHA areas and additional 150 three seater passengers chairs.
The most significant difference at the security hold has been the increase in seating capacity. The earlier area was 26000 sqft which is further extended to 19000 Sq ft i.e. increase of 73% almost double. Now everyone has comfortable sitting while waiting for boarding the flights. The increase in the number of display screens showing the flight status and more CCTV for security also helps,” said Sharad Kumar, Airport Director, Srinagar International Airport. One upgraded multicuisine restaurant will also be an attraction in security hold area in addition to other snacks bar counter and CCD.
One frequent flier whispered that “I used to be annoyed while waiting for boarding at the old security hold area of Srinagar airport owing to the limited seating space and long queues at the time of boarding during peak hours that spared nobody. I am delighted with the new, swanky look. I believe it is on a par with most other airports in the country and more spacious with more seating capacity and other facilities,”
In order to provide world class services and efficient facilitation for hassle free easier movement of travelers Shri Sharad Kumar, Airport Director, SIA informed that two (2) more boarding gates are added which will provide direct access to the aerobridge thereby ensuring smooth, less walking and timely boarding of the aircrafts.
Another attraction will be a SPA where passengers can get different therapies to sooth their nerves and relax before boarding the flights. AAI has been creating more and more facilities for the passengers delight and preparing for the growth of traffic so that passengers have maximum comfort during their journey.
